I would prefer substantially increasing the size of Parliament so that there are more electorates to moving away from proportional populations. Rural, sparsely-populated areas tend to be whiter and more National-voting than the nation as a whole, so this could reduce diversity and create imbalances.

the coalition’s decision to overturn β€œre edwards”, the case establishing the test to obtain customary title under the marine and coastal areas act, is in effect the re-establishment of the foreshore and seabed act: overturning the case means extinguishing customary title to the foreshore and seabed
